    My date and time is wrong and I cant seem to fix it. I have it set to set automatic time and time zone but it sets it to pacific time when I am central. It shows its 2 hours behind. I would set it manually but then I have trouble with programs not working correctly as the date and time isn't working. I've tried syncing the time with the internet windows time but that doesn't fix it either. In summary, my options are: Set automatic but my time is behind 2 hours or manual set my time to be correct but some of my programs don't work due to time issues. Anyone have a solution, I tried looking at forums but couldn't find anything.

    I would also suggest you to manually set up your computer to synchronize with Windows time by following the steps below:

    1. Type "date and time" in the search bar and open it.

    2. Click on "internet time" tab.

    3. Click on "change settings".

    4. Check "synchronize with an internet time server"

    5. Under server, select time.windows.com
    from the drop down list.

    6. Click on "update now" and click
    ok.

    7. Restart your computer and check if the issue persists.

    Also make sure the time zone is set correctly by following the steps below:

    1. Press Windows key + I

    2. Click on "time and language".

    3. Click on "date and time"

    4. Choose the appropriate time zone from the drop down list.

    I suggest you to change the Date and Time format from Control Panel and check. Also select the time zone as UTC-5.00 Eastern Time.


    After changing the setting, I suggest you to set “Windows Time” service as automatic. Follow the steps provided below.

    • Press Windows logo Key + R key.
    • Type services.msc
    • Right click on Windows Time service.
    • Select Properties.
    • Under startup type drop down, change it to Automatic.
    • Click on Apply button and OK button.
    Restart your computer and check.
